    Use a magnifying glass and a strong light and see if you can retrieve the key.  It is not registered anywhere except on the label.  They are applied at the factory in batches, and there is no record that the key is affixed to a specific computer.  Recover what you can and then try to activate by phone.

    To activate Windows Vista by phone, follow these steps: click Start, and then click computer.  Click System Properties on the toolbar, and then click click here to activate Windows now in the Windows activation area.

    If you are prompted for an administrator password or a confirmation, type the password, or click on continue.  The Windows of Activation Wizard starts.  Click use the telephone system automated in the Windows Wizard of Activation.

    Unfortunately, this is probably what you're going to do, buy another copy of Windows (or another computer).  When Windows comes pre-installed on a computer, the Windows installation is allowed on this computer and cannot be moved to another.  In order to have a component to show up and say: "it is the computer that I came!", this component is the motherboard.  Now that yours has been replaced, the Windows license that came with the old motherboard is zero and cannot be used any longer.
